MHS forensics team places first
Marion High School forensics team placed first Saturday at the Northern Heights Forensics Tournament.
Trevor Jones placed first in solo humorous. Tedra Eis was third.
Jones and Michael Brookens were first in duet acting. Jordan Timm and Elisa Gayle were fourth.
Timm and Gayle placed second in IDA.
Nicole Nelson was fifth in solo serious. Anda Malesau was sixth in prose. Jenna Parli was second in poetry.
Sasha Mikheyeva competed in the extemporaneous division.
The team will compete Saturday at Council Grove.
